Organizations still suffer from information deficiency because of poor methods of data storage, unpredictability of information that will be vital in future. It is often hard to identify what information will become vital to organizations in the future hence information deficiency (Hovanov, 1996).The notion of Information Deficiency integrates both user perceived importance and user perceived availability of an information category. How information system affect organization?
Information systems can reduce the number of levels in an organization by providing managers with information to supervise larger numbers of workers and by giving lower-level employees more decision-making authority.

What is the relationship between information and data?
Data is a collection of facts. Information is how you understand those facts in context. Data is unorganized, while information is structured or organized. Information is an uncountable noun, while data is a mass noun.

What is a work deficiency?
Chronic or continuous performance deficiencies exist when an employee fails to meet the minimally acceptable standards of performance for the job over a period of time. Chronic deficient performance often includes time and attendance issues, poor work quality, excessive mistakes, missed deadlines, and low productivity.
What does deficiency work mean?
Deficient Work – Work not in reasonably close conformance with the contract requirements, or otherwise inferior, but in the opinion of the Engineer, reasonably acceptable for its intended use and allowed to remain in place.
